Compared by dimension
On an average United Arab Emirates income of €72,000 gross per year, you keep €55,315 net in South Korea: a difference of €16,685 per year compared with United Arab Emirates.
- Tax: on this income South Korea lands at an effective rate of about 23%, against 0% in United Arab Emirates.
- Passport and mobility: from South Korea you travel visa-free to 188 countries.
- Residency: on our accessibility scale South Korea scores 40 out of 100 for obtaining residency.
- Living environment: banking, internet, safety and healthcare together give South Korea a living-environment score of 80 out of 100.
